âPresident Trump is reportedly considering a major policy shift: blocking US tech companies from outsourcing jobs to India.
âThis isn't just politics; itâs a direct threat to India's $250 billion IT services industry (TCS, Infosys, Wipro, etc.), which relies heavily on US contracts.
âđ The Financial Impact:
âRisk to Indian IT Stocks: Any concrete move (like an outright ban or a proposed 25% outsourcing tax via the HIRE Act) could severely impact margins and future revenue guidance. Watch the sector closely!
âWider Economic Jitters: This escalates trade tensions and forces US companies to rethink their entire global cost structure.
âThe 'America First' Effect: The push to 'Make Call Centres American Again' signals a clear protectionist policy that could lead to widespread job loss in India and higher operating costs for US businesses.
